JURIKOM (Jurnal Riset Komputer)
JURIKOM (Jurnal Riset Komputer) membahas ilmu dibidang Informatika, Sistem Informasi, Manajemen Informatika, DSS, AI, ES, Jaringan, sebagai wadah dalam menuangkan hasil penelitian baik secara konseptual maupun teknis yang berkaitan dengan Teknologi Informatika dan Komputer. Topik utama yang diterbitkan mencakup: 1. Teknik Informatika 2. Sistem Informasi 3. Sistem Pendukung Keputusan 4. Sistem Pakar 5. Kecerdasan Buatan 6. Manajemen Informasi 7. Data Mining 8. Big Data 9. Jaringan Komputer 10. Dan lain-lain (topik lainnya yang berhubungan dengan Teknologi Informati dan komputer)

Abstract

When you use a software keyword that is searched on a website, there are a lot of sites that provide the software, it takes a long time to get the files needed because they are looking for files manually and there are no categories or groupings of software needed. In correcting the writer using the Zhu-Takaoka Algorithm, Zhu-Takaoka is a modified algorithm of the Boyer-Moore algorithm. The Zhu-Takaoka algorithm uses a two-dimensional array to calculate and execute functions from left to left which allows you to make mistakes, find applications that can be done quickly and easily with the stack of programs or applications in the repository. The expected design of this Linux repository application can run well in all devices that have a browser, and this designed application also allows you to search for debian (.deb) Linux programs using the name of the software you are looking for.

Abstract

A broadcasting technician is a person in charge of preparing, running, and maintaining electronic equipment used to broadcast television shows, controlling audio equipment to adjust the volume level and sound quality during radio and television broadcasts, running the transmitter to broadcast television shows. To get a reliable broadcasting technician cannot be separated from the recruitment of these technicians to television stations. The broadcasting technician recruitment system carried out at Televisi Republik Indonesia (TVRI) Medan is through a selection stage based on the required criteria using the interview process and the availability of the selection participant files. The weakness that is often experienced by users of the recruitment system is that it is difficult for the leadership to give the final decision regarding the selection participants who deserve to be accepted in an efficient time. To assist the leadership of Televisi Republik Indonesia (TVRI) Medan in the decision-making process in selecting a broadcasting technician, a computer-based application is needed in the form of a decision support system that can provide supporting output for the decision-making. A decision support system is a system that has the ability to solve problems with structured and unstructured problem conditions that have a role in helping problem solving and no one knows how decisions should be made. Decision support systems can be used in assisting the decision making of a selection assessment. Decision support systems aim to provide predictions, provide information and direct information users to be able to make decisions more effectively and efficiently.

Abstract

The size of the text file is relatively large, where the more information contained in the file, the larger the size of the text file needed to store the information, so that it has an impact on the file size that must be stored on the storage media. The memory size required to store a file is directly proportional to the size of the text file. The problem that occurs is the limited storage space available, especially for Android applications. If the text file size is larger than the storage space or the maximum size limit for a file, sending the text file will fail or the information contained in the text file will not be conveyed properly. This research studies text file compression techniques using arithmetic coding, and implements it for compression and decompression cases. Things to be studied include: looking at the effect of character variations in a text on the compression ratio, the resulting compression time and the decompression time. The experimental results show that the highest compression ratio is obtained when a text has only one type of character. The effect of character variations on the compression ratio is that the more character variations a text has, the lower the compression ratio.

Abstract

Determining the best ranking of districts in the Province of North Sumatra is done by determining the existing criteria, so the North Sumatra provincial government will easily determine which districts will be ranked as the best districts. selection is done by looking at the data that is in the North Sumatra provincial government and how the district has performed for the previous year. The problem faced by the selection team is how to determine the best districts from a number of alternatives that have advantages and disadvantages of each district so that they are not well targeted in providing the best assessment to be analyzed. This system is a Decision Support System (SPK) which was built using the WASPAS method and designed using Microsoft Visual Studio 2008 and using a Microsoft Access database. Data processing will be carried out by the Selection Team from North Sumatra provincial government by entering data or criteria for the district. then the system will perform calculations according to the WASPAS principle which will eventually produce a ranking of the best districts in the province of North Sumatra.
